Interesting cap. have you been able to handle it ar or you just going on the photographs ?
The exterior screams Erel made cap as it has the high shape at the front and the give away vented cockade. the interior tells us that the cap was supplied via a distributor but the sweatband is one i've not seen before on an erel. Could be a replacement maybe ? If you can handle the cap get some shots of the grommit on the front cap band and the sweatband to see if it is marked as an erel made cap.
